The main requirements of a spindle bearing are that it should enable the spindle to rotate smoothly with a minimum of vibration or deflection under load and with the least possible wear or rise in temperature. The aim of this study is to investigate the influence of tribological properties of lubricant on the reliability of spindle bearings of grinding machines. Spindle bearings operate under a wide range of operating conditions e.g. bearing temperature, speed, load and presence or otherwise of moisture. Plain bearings as spindle bearings exhibit conformal surfaces that are the surfaces fit into each other with a high degree of geometrical conformity, so that the load is carried over a relative large area. Lubrication is the significant importance to the prevention of spindle bearings from tribological processes and wears which cause failure of machines. The experimental investigation of the influence of lubricating oils on the tribological behavior of spindle bearings has been carried out on grinding machines at a metalworking factory.
